Your 30s are a critical time for wealth-building. With time on your side, your investments can grow significantly. Here’s why you should start now:
– Compound interest works in your favor
– The sooner you invest, the more time your money has to grow.-Higher risk tolerance
– You have more years before retirement, allowing you to take calculated risks. -Better financial discipline
– You likely have a stable income and can plan long-term.
While investing in your 30s has many advantages, there are challenges too. Understanding them helps you make informed decisions.
1. Student Loan Debt
Many 30-somethings are still paying off student loans. Balancing debt repayment and investing is crucial.
Tip: Prioritize high-interest debt first while allocating some money to investments.
